WebThe Trident II D5 missile was designed and manufactured in the United States by Lockheed Martin. Under the Polaris Sales Agreement (modified for Trident), the UK has title to 58 missiles. Aside from those currently deployed, the missiles are held in a communal pool at the US Strategic Weapons facility at King's Bay, Georgia, USA. WebD5 ballistic missile. WebThe Missiles. The FBM Weapon System Missiles evolved from the single warhead POLARIS A1 and A2 and the multiple warhead A3, through the independently targetable multiple warhead POSEIDON C3 and TRIDENT I (C4), to the current TRIDENT II (D5) missile. Each new design provided successive improvements in range or payload, accuracy, and target ...
